Tibullus is considered one of the finest exponents of Latin lyric in the golden age of Rome, during the Emperor Augustus' reign, and his poetry retains its enduring beauty and appeal. Together these works provide an important document for anyone who seeks to understand Roman culture and sexuality and the origins of Western poetry. The new translation by Rodney Dennis and Michael Putnam conveys to students the elegance and wit of the original poems. This title is ideal for courses on classical literature, classical civilization, Roman history, comparative literature, and the classical tradition and reception. The Latin verses will be printed side-by-side with the English text. Explanatory notes and a glossary elucidate context and describe key names, places, and events. An introduction by Julia Haig Gaisser provides the necessary historical and social background to the poet's life and works. This title includes the poems of Sulpicia and Lygdamus, transmitted with the text of Tibullus and formerly ascribed to him.

The author was part of a circle of poets who experimented with new forms of poetry and whose work would significantly influence the development of Latin literature. The elegies in this book are addressed to a lost love named Neara and grapple with the complexities of relationships, the pain of separation, and the enduring power of love. The author uses vivid imagery and evocative language to create a deeply personal and moving exploration of these universal human experiences, offering insights into the nature of love and longing that continue to resonate with readers today.
